Slow the play speed down, if you are not sure. Hes got his arms underneath the dudes armpits. As the attacker comes in, he steps back + sinks into the ground... changing the vector of the OPs mass... while at the same time, charging up his own potentials (leg springs). When the OP has nearly ran out of forwards momentum, and a lot of it has passed into him... he adds the OPs mass energy to his own.. by Springing his legs upwards, and his whole body upwards. Since he is connected at the OPs armpits... and he has a lot of momentum from the OP left over to aid his upwards body mass movement... it becomes fairly easy to lift and toss him. While you might be able to do this without help from the OPs forwards energy... it would take a lot more muscle power to do so. In this method of changing the mass vectors... it reduces the need for massive bulky muscles. Just need excellent Core strength, and precision mastered technique.
